The solemn repatriation of 1,000 fallen Ukrainian servicemen underscores Ukraine's ongoing commitment to honoring its defenders. As the Coordination Headquarters continues this crucial task, the nation mourns notable losses, including Oleksandr Savov, a brave marine from Azovstal. President Zelenskyy recently awarded honors to 418 dedicated servicemen, acknowledging the ultimate sacrifice of 127 posthumous recipients. What is the significance of Ukraine repatriating servicemen's bodies?

Repatriating the bodies of fallen servicemen is a solemn duty that honors the sacrifices made by soldiers and provides closure to their families. It reflects Ukraine's commitment to remembering its defenders and upholding national dignity, particularly in the context of ongoing conflict.

How is Ukraine supporting its servicemembers during wartime?

Ukraine supports its servicemembers through state honors, policy adaptations, and welfare programs. The Winter Support program is a recent initiative to aid military and civilian needs. Furthermore, the government is addressing legal frameworks for servicemen and enhancing contractual terms to boost morale and readiness.

What recent honors have been awarded to Ukrainian servicemembers?

President Zelenskyy has recently awarded state honors to 418 servicemembers, with 127 awarded posthumously. These honors reflect a recognition of exceptional valor and dedication in defending the nation, illustrating the highest gratitude and respect for their service.

What challenges do Ukrainian servicemembers face regarding resources and support?

Challenges include balancing resource allocation amidst financial constraints and ensuring support reaches all brigades effectively. The recent discussion regarding the Winter Support program highlights the need for comprehensive funding strategies to sustain military operations and personnel welfare under ongoing conflict conditions.

How is Ukraine addressing legal issues involving servicemen in court proceedings?

The Supreme Court has delineated when courts must suspend or continue proceedings involving servicemen. This legal clarification aims to ensure fair and timely legal processes, taking into account the complexities faced by servicemen engaged in national defense duties.
